Coroners' Inquests are inquests conducted by six men, on behalf of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, into the cause of a person's death. Inquests include: municipality; name of coroner; signatures of the six jurors; name of decedent; date of inquest; reason for death; name of coroner's physician, and names of witnesses to the inquest. Cause of death: from being struck by Engine No.647 hauling train No.85 on Pennsylvania Railroad leaving Columbia at 2:45 P.M. going west while carelessly walking track in tunnel west of Columbia.
Deputy Coroner: Hershey, H. S.
Coroner's Physician: Craig, Alexander.
Jurors: Bockius, S. A.; Morrisson, S.; Gilbert, Aron H.; Jessel, A.; Bachenheimer, M.; Vossen, J.
